织梦栏目内容不显示-织梦企业模板-站长建站的模板站
Website Home
这个是一个图片的列表页,所以有这个页面的css的话,只需要使用织梦的标签调用就行,{dede:arclistrow=20titlelen=50typeid=47}[field:idfunction=GetTags(@me)/][field:title/]{/dede:arclist}就是这样的标签了。最简单的和其他栏目模板一样在调用文章列表那块改成调用栏目内容{dedefield.content}先安装,然后更新栏目内容,更新网站首页就可以了。是因为你在内容模型管理中添加字段的时候,它会有一个选项,就是询问你是否要底层调用这个标签,只有勾选上了才能通过织梦标签调用,否则的话不能调用,你可以尝试着在channeltype这个表中的listfields字段中加上你的这个字段名,用逗号隔开DedeCMS织梦内容模型管理添加的新字段,都不能添加上数据是什么原因?比如图片是新添加的字段,在添加信息的时候候,填写的信息,就是添加不上,数据库还是空的。回复讨论(解决方案)如果你有兴趣的话,可以看看他的代码。如果你有兴趣的话,可以看看他的代码。看哪部分,涉及的静态模板文件和php文件都看过了没有什么问题,另外我这个问题之前是不存在的。怎么会了.有没有什么报错你模型选择自动的怎么会了.有没有什么报错你模型选择自动的就是选的自动生成表单字段现在人就是懒去数据库里添加下能咋滴亲,这个要在后台模板改,不是改你根目录的index.html那个页面哦!第一:要在/templets/default/下修改你的head.htm这个模板,这是默认的哦,你的要是不放在这个里面的话,那就是放在index.htm这个模板里面;第二:如果不是上面第一种情况,那可能你的就是直接用代码调用的,这样你就需要在后台进行栏目名称修改了,改好栏目名称后生成静态就行了!你是要点栏目1内的任何一张图片,打开的是频道1列表,而不是图片内容页是吗?那你就手动设置连接就可以了啊,手动设置栏目1的链接为频道1的链接不就解决啦?为什么一定要用标签呢{dede:arclisttypeid=栏目idrow=10titlelen=0flag=porderby=pubdate}[field:imglink/][field:textlink/]{/dede:arclist}你的机器内存太小或者织梦数据库本来要求的内存太大这篇文章主要介绍了织梦dedecms获取当前栏目路径及栏目名称的方法,需要的朋友可以参考下dedecms模板下载地址:www.gxlcms.com/xiazai/code/dedecms标签如下:当前:代码如下:{dede:type}<ahref="[field:typelink/]">[field:typename/]</a>{/dede:type}因为{dede:fieldname='arcurl'/}这个获取当前页面路径的标签只能在内容页使用,栏目页没有效果的。所以在栏目页想获取当前栏目的路径及名称的话,就要用上面这个标签。而获取网站所有栏目名称及路径列表的话,就要用到另一个标签:{dede:channel},调用方式如下:所有栏目代码如下:<ul>{dede:channeltype='top'row='11'}<liclass="navbg"><ahref='[field:typelink/]'>[field:typename/]</a></li>{/dede:channel}</ul>织梦dedeCMS网站栏目页获取当前栏目的顶级栏目名称的标签教程:我们在使用做一些网站的时候,时常会碰到需要调用当前栏目的顶级栏目名称的时候,织梦默认{dede:fieldname='typename'/}可以获取当前栏目页上一级栏目的名称,而不是当前栏目顶级栏目名称。下面拓展出一个方法来实现这个效果、:在include/common.func.php的最下方加入:内容来自顶级栏目名代码如下:functionGetTopTypename($id){global$dsql;$row=$dsql->GetOne("SELECTtypename,topidFROMjiemou_arctypeWHEREid=$id");if($row['topid']=='0'){return$row['typename'];}else{$row1=$dsql->GetOne("SELECTtypenameFROMjiemou_arctypeWHEREid=$row[topid]");return$row1['typename'];}}在文章页或者栏目列表页调用时,在所要调用栏目名称的位置加上下面这行代码即可实现。内容来自{dede:fieldname='typeid'function="GetTopTypename(@me)"/}内容来自在文章页中用下面这个方法来调用获取当前栏目的父栏目写成一个函数放入include/extend.func.php文件中代码如下:functionGetParentCategoryNameByID($CurrentID){$tsql=newDedeSql(false);$typelink2=''$tsql->SetQuery("Selecti.typedir,i.typenameFromzz5unet_arctypetleftjoinzz5unet_arctypeioni.id=t.reidwheret.id='$CurrentID'");$tsql->Execute('t');while($row=$tsql->GetArray('t'MYSQL_ASSOC)){$typelink2.=$row['typename'];}return$typelink2;}调用方法:{dede:fieldname='id'function='GetParentCategoryNameByID(@me)'/}最近朋友们向我推荐一个好去处里有一款内容丰富且实用易懂的《新浪博客教程》内容涵盖:新浪博客新手入门指南,新浪博客升级指南,播放器涂鸦板留言板等各类饰物的代码,疑难问题解答,博客个人首页的修饰与美化等等地址在: